There are many NH hotels in Madrid. To give you an idea of what to expect from them, we've reviewed one of the most central hotels.

The NH Hotel Madrid Embajada is in an attractive cream-coloured building with a decorative façade. The street it's on is wide and lined with trees and the whole area has a majestic feel.

Inside you'll find the hotel is simply decorated with large pictured dotted about on the walls. Overall there's neat, no-fuss feel.

Hotel Facilities

NH Hotel Madrid Embajada has excellent facilities including: a restaurant, cocktail bar, café bar, laundry service, cloakroom service, airport shuttle service, medical help on hand, babysitting and you can book car rental through reception.


Business Facilities

The NH Hotel Madrid Embajada has 4 meeting rooms and the biggest can hold up to 50 people. The hotel can provide: overhead projector, screens, fax, microphone, flip chart, audiovisual equipment, hostesses, translation, computers, and will cater for working lunches, cocktail parties and coffee breaks.


Rooms

There are 101 rooms altogether, (including a junior suite) and each of the rooms at the NH Hotel Madrid Embajada has: Satellite TV, direct-dial telephone, pay per view films and video games, wi-fi internet access, minibar, AC, toiletries kit, hairdryer, piped music, choice of pillows, 12 hour room service, and 2 types of breakfast - buffet breakfast or early riser breakfast.

The rooms are modern and light, and external rooms have views across the tree lines street towards the Alonso Martinez roundabout.


Hotel Location And Facilities

It's just 1 minute walk to the metro from the hotel and there are excellent connections to all parts of Madrid. If you cross over the Alonso Martinez roundabout, in 10 minutes walk you'll be in the district of Chueca, where all the gay, alternative and Bohemian shops and bars can be found.

Heading straight down the hill on Calle Genova from the roundabout will take you past many bars and restaurants. There's an American style diner, a place to get ribs, tapas bars, sandwich bars, cake shops and just about every type of food you can think of!

On the same street as the hotel there's a cash point and a pharmacy. The street is fairly peaceful and has some pleasant architecture.


How To Get From The Airport To The Hotel

Via Taxi: A taxi from the airport should take about 20 minutes and cost around €19.50 (including airport supplement), if there isn't too much traffic, and assuming there is no extra baggage (that all baggage fits inside the boot and interior of the taxi).

Via metroMetro: You can take various metro routes directly from the airport to arrive at Alonso Martinez metro near the NH Hotel Madrid Embajada. Line number 8 leaves from inside the airport between terminals 1 and 2. Here's the best route to take:

metroMetro: Nuevos Ministerios (Pink Line, L8) Then change and head for Alonso Martinez (Dark Blue Line, L10).

Via Bus: You can take a red EMT public bus from the airport to Avenida America. The number bus that takes this route is the 115. From there it's quicker to change to the metro directly to Alonso Martinez (Brown Line, L4).

In A Nutshell

The NH Hotel Madrid Embajada is in a great place for you to enjoy some excellent bars and restaurants. It has really good metro links with the rest of Madrid and you can reach the commercial centre within 10 minutes.

Tourist Transport Pass

Madrid Tourist Travel Pass gives you free unlimited transport on the Madrid metro underground, buses and trains in the city centre. The Tourist Travel Pass is a convenient and trouble-free way for you to travel around Madrid centre without having to worry about purchasing tickets in Spanish. Hop on Hop off Tourist Bus

If you want to see Madrid's Main attactions there is no more convenient way to get around than the popular Madrid hop on hop off Tourist Bus. It covers most of Madrid's important attractions so you can feel confident that you will see the best the city has to offer with the minimum of planning. Simply hop on the bus to take you to the next attraction, hop off to see it, then hop back on again when you're ready to move on to the next attraction.
